7 ADJUSTMENTS
7.5.1
HEIGHT OF CUT ADJUSTMENT (WING AND FRONT UNITS) __________________
The cutting height is determined by the position of the rear roller in relation to the castor wheels. Changes to this
height are made at these points and can be made in any order. Make adjustment selections for each flail cutting
unit from the height of cut chart that is included within this section.
Rear roller setup
1. Start the engine and raise the cutting units into the transport position then engage deck locks. Turn off engine
and remove the ignition key.
2. Loosen the M8 nut (Pivot Point) for the bearing housing, Do not remove.
3. Adjust the rear roller to suit the grass conditions being cut, remove both M8 nuts, bolts and serrated washers
then rotate the adjustment plate and roller to the desired hole position.

Position "A" - This setting is recommended for areas with short grass where small volume of material is
discharged from the cutting units.
Position "B" - This is the default setting from Jacobsen Ltd, this setting is suitable for variable
grass height areas.
Position "C" - This setting MUST be used in long grass areas where large volumes of material is being
cut and discharged from the cutting units.
4. Insert the M8 bolts and serrated washers into the new adjustment plate hole positions, and secure in place
with the M8 nuts and serrated washers, tighten to 24 Nm (17.7 ft lbs).
5. Tighten the M8 nut for the bearing housing to 24 Nm (17.7 ft-lbf).
6. Repeat instructions two to three on the opposite side of the cutting unit.
7. Visually inspect all adjustment plates to ensure that it is secured with two bolts on each side of the cutting unit.
8. Repeat instructions 2 to 5 for the remaining cutting units.
